Output f3daf294139aaecccba106e49e5c1f232267a1befe78d0d6534b890d2766fa5b:1

value
45629272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 578e905f47f0eb28325b02661bf8d85fa1bcc2c8 OP_EQUAL
address
MFt7odsnvzs9BPPnzZjK46GU17agc3Ttyq
transaction
f3daf294139aaecccba106e49e5c1f232267a1befe78d0d6534b890d2766fa5b
spent
true